TL;DR: DO NOT RENT HERE!!! SECURITY ISSUES! @Homestead, do better.

I moved in to 50 Laurier in 2021 when Quadreal owned the building and had a fantastic experience living here for 2 years. Then, in late 2023, Homestead bought the building.

To cut costs, they have removed every single aspect of the building that made it a nice place to live. There is no more security, where there used to be an attendant 24/7; they have reduced hours for the amenities (e.g. pool and saunas); the lobby furniture has gone missing from several floors (I asked about this and they said they would "look into it" - this was 4 months ago, still no return).

On top of removing the nice things, they have actively made things worse. The new parcel delivery system simply does not work, and packages are regularly left sitting out in the lobby (see photo below) which might not be a big issue if there were still security. There is REGULAR construction from 9am-7pm, sometimes on Friday evenings and weekends, with no warning.

Finally, the management and other staff is terrible. Once again to cut costs, Homestead removed all of the staff that had been around for years and knew how to do their jobs well, and replaced them with a skeleton crew of workers who don't really know what they're doing. Their communication is atrocious - my emails regularly go without response and there is VERY rarely anyone in the office to speak to. They still owe me money from an account error that they made a year ago. The cleaning staff is sub-par and mostly absent, so elevators constantly are dirty and have a strange smell.
If I could, I would give them 0 stars for service.

Other aspects to consider:
- Because it was built as a hotel, the walls are actually pretty thick, which means sound isolation in units is quite good (this is one thing Homestead actually can't mess up).
- The area is pretty nice and close to the mall, but a little noisy at times and underserved by grocery stores. However, it can be an unsafe area and Homestead is not taking the necessary steps to make the building secure.
- It is pretty close to the LRT line, which is nice.

EDIT: came back to add that building staff informed me there was a recent incident where a suspected homeless person entered the building, stole many of the packages that are left lying around, and ran out. Others have been found stealing cushions from patio furniture and sleeping in the stairwell. I have personally seen homeless people going through the bins in the garage, where it is possible to enter the rest of the building.

This is now a security issue, and homestead does not care. Do not rent here.
